What is the Daily Medication Administration Record?
The Daily Medication Administration Record is a vital form utilized in healthcare settings to track medication administration to patients. This record features key components, including fields for date, time, initials, comments, and duration of the medication given. Accurate medication administration is crucial for patient safety, ensuring that each individual receives the correct dosage at the right times.

Common Errors and How to Avoid Them
Several frequent mistakes may occur when filling out the Daily Medication Administration Record, including:
-
Omitting critical fields such as date or time.
-
Failing to provide adequate comments or duration information.
-
Incorrect initials or signatures.
To ensure accuracy and completeness of the form, double-check all information before submission.
